The finale to the 2012 ‘Keeping it Living’ campaign is fast approaching, this Saturday, July 28 at the K’omoks Band Hall & shoreline.
It looks like it will be good weather for the estuary flotilla, the nature walks & the salmon BBQ, and inside the Band Hall will be displays & activities, especially the ‘Art for the Estuary’. Over 30 artists have submitted more than 50 artworks including painting, photography, mixed media, glass & metal art.
The ‘Keeping it Living’ campaign is raising awareness for the protection & restoration of the Courtenay River (K’omoks) Estuary, as well as a fundraiser, so there are many ways to contribute your support: from sponsorships of $25 for an art poster, $100 for a limited edition art print, or bidding on the beautiful artworks starting from $100 to $3500.
